合肥信息学竞赛试题及答案.docVIP

  • 2
  • 0
  • 约2.57千字
  • 约 10页
  • 2026-05-23 发布于四川
  • 举报

合肥信息学竞赛试题及答案

一、单项选择题(每题2分,共20分)

1.以下哪种数据结构最适合实现优先队列?()

A.栈

B.队列

C.堆

D.链表

2.以下哪种排序算法的平均时间复杂度为O(nlogn)?()

A.冒泡排序

B.插入排序

C.快速排序

D.选择排序

3.若一个二叉树的前序遍历序列为ABCDE,中序遍历序列为CBADE,则该二叉树的后序遍历序列为()

A.CBEAD

B.CBEDA

C.CDEBA

D.CEDBA

4.以下哪个不是图的存储结构?()

A.邻接矩阵

B.邻接表

C.哈希表

D.十字链表

5.递归函数在执行时,需要借助()来保存临时数据。

A.栈

B.队列

C.数组

D.链表

6.以下哪种算法用于查找图中的最短路径?()

A.深度优先搜索

B.广度优先搜索

C.Dijkstra算法

D.拓扑排序

7.对于一个有n个元素的数组,二分查找的时间复杂度是()

A.O(n)

B.O(logn)

C.O(n^2)

D.O(1)

8.以下哪种数据结构是先进后出的?()

A.栈

B.队列

C.树

D.图

9.若要对一个数组进行排序,且要求排序稳定,以下哪种排序算法合适?()

A.快速排序

B.堆排序

C.归并排序

D.

文档评论(0)

1亿VIP精品文档

相关文档